An array is a collection of objects, pictures or numbers arranged in rows and columns. Teach your kids two ways to interpret an array with this fun worksheet. Represent it in terms of rows or columns then have your student draw a line to the beehive to discover the correct number sentence.

Explain to your child that an array is a group of objects, pictures, or numbers in columns and rows. Show them a rectangular array is a group of objects in equal rows and columns. Guide them to check the pictures in the worksheet to spot any rectangular arrays. Help them remember this concept.

This worksheet helps your child learn to identify and represent arrays. For example, both 3+3+3+3=12 and 4+4+4=12 are arrays but the first is arranged in rows and the second in columns. Let your child use this knowledge to answer the four questions in this pdf and check the two correct equations.

Easy worksheets on Arrays, specifically tailored for ages 7-8, serve as a foundational stepping stone into the world of mathematics and problem-solving. At this crucial learning stage, children are just beginning to understand the patterns and structures that form the basis of math. Arrays, as a concept, introduce them to multiplication and division in a visual and tangible way, making these abstract concepts more accessible and less intimidating.

The simplicity of Easy Arrays for Ages 7-8 is what makes them particularly useful. By presenting multiplication and division problems as arrangements of objects or symbols, children can visually count and group items, aiding their comprehension of these operations. This method not only reinforces their counting skills but also encourages flexible thinking as they explore different ways to group objects.
